Hill closes the curtain on Brabham's glorious story

On this day in 1992, the Brabham name appeared for the very last time on a Grand Prix grid, thanks to a valiant effort by one Damon Hill. In the years that preceded its demise, Brabham pretty much owed its survival to artificial respiration.  Budgets were of the shoestring type, its cars were unreliable and uncompetitive while results were predictably non-existent. It all came to a head at the Hungarian Grand Prix, where a tenacious Damon Hill qualified his BT60B on the last row before enduring a hopeless run to P11.
